Find Fire Extinguishers near me in Lesnes Abbey
Unit 14E Thames Gateway Park, Chequers Lane, Dagenham, RM9 6FB
Select Fire Extinguishers by borough in London
This web site uses cookies to improve your experience and by viewing our content you accept their use. Click
here to remove this notice.